āœØ What goes into a marketing or social media strategy?

When you know what you need to achieve, why you need to achieve it and how youā€™re going to know when youā€™ve achieved it - thatā€™s a strategy. 

Your marketing or social media strategy requires an in-depth understanding of your business objectives,  the competitive landscape, your existing and future customers and all that good stuff. Your strategy will include details of your customers or clients and their wants, needs and behaviours. 

Though your strategy wonā€™t need details of messaging and creative, it should include a breakdown of the channels you intend to use and why. Itā€™s also helpful to include an audit of your own and your competitors marketing channels.

āœØ What goes into a marketing or social media plan?

Once youā€™ve finalised your strategy, you can look at how youā€™re going to actually implement it. A marketing or social media plan would include the ā€˜how stuffā€™, including things like; how often you post; what creative to use; when to post; what to post and, all that implementation stuff. 

šŸ‘‰šŸ» Why does knowing the difference between a marketing or social media strategy and plan matter?

A plan should support a strategy not be one, because leading with ā€˜howā€™ before ā€˜whyā€™ means you are likely to be just guessing. This leads to wasted time and inconsistency - something your customers wonā€™t respond well to.
